What is mutual authentication? Two-way authentication
WebThere are three main methods for mutually authenticating the ends of a communications channel: 1. Public key authentication: This method relies on public key cryptography. A key is a string of data that can be used to encrypt or digitally sign data. Public key cryptography uses two keys — a public key and a private key.
